Summary
STARLINK-32037, also known as Starlink 32037, is a communication satellite belonging to SpaceX (SPXS). It was launched on July 28, 2024, from the Cape Canaveral Space Force Station Launch Complex 40 using a Falcon 9 launch vehicle. The satellite measures 0.3 meters in length and has a diameter of 4.1 meters with a span of 29 meters. It has a dry mass of 700 kilograms and was launched with a total mass of 730 kilograms. Equipped with Ku/Ka/E-band payload and optical inter-satellite link, it uses solar arrays and batteries for power supply. The satellite is stabilized using Argon ion thrusters and features a box plus panel shape configuration known as Starlink v2 Mini.

Starlink is a satellite constellation developed by SpaceX with the aim of providing global broadband internet coverage. Thousands of small satellites are deployed in low Earth orbit (LEO), enabling high-speed internet access even in remote areas. However, the rapid increase in satellites raises concerns about space debris and the potential for collisions, which can lead to further debris creation and endanger other spacecraft. Additionally, the sheer number of Starlink satellites can affect astronomical observations by increasing light pollution. Proper deorbiting plans and international coordination are essential to mitigate these challenges and ensure long-term sustainability in space.
